Standardized document querying in VS Code Copilot

Implement `search_federal_documents` to let your team query rules via chat. It keeps everyone aligned on the same source of truth. Your engineers get the data they need without leaving VS Code. It turns complex government searches into simple natural language requests.

Monitor agency availability in VS Code Copilot

Use `check_api_status` to verify if the government feed is healthy. You can build this into your team's routine checks. It prevents wasted time when the upstream service is down. Your team sees the status right in the Copilot Chat interface.

Automated document ingestion in VS Code Copilot

Run `get_federal_document_details` to pull metadata for your compliance tools. It allows your Copilot agent to draft documentation based on real rules. This makes your compliance process repeatable. You spend less time searching and more time shipping code.

Setup guide

Set up Federal Register API MCP in VS Code Copilot

Prerequisites

  • VS Code 1.99 or later with GitHub Copilot extension
  • Active Vinkius subscription with a valid endpoint token
  1. 1

    Open MCP configuration

    Open the Command Palette (Cmd+Shift+P / Ctrl+Shift+P) and run "MCP: Add Server". Select HTTP (Streamable) as the server type. VS Code will create .vscode/mcp.json in your workspace.

  2. 2

    Add the Federal Register API MCP

    Paste the JSON snippet shown on the right into your .vscode/mcp.json. Replace [YOUR_TOKEN_HERE] with your endpoint token from cloud.vinkius.com.

  3. 3

    Switch to Agent mode

    Open Copilot Chat (Cmd+Shift+I / Ctrl+Shift+I) and switch to Agent mode using the dropdown. MCP tools are only available in Agent mode — they do not appear in Edit or Ask modes.

  4. 4

    Verify the connection

    In the Copilot Chat input, type # to list available tools. You should see the Federal Register API tools listed. Try asking: "List my recent Federal Register API transactions" and Copilot will invoke them automatically.

.vscode/mcp.json
{
  "mcpServers": {
    "federal-register-api-mcp": {
      "url": "https://edge.vinkius.com/[YOUR_TOKEN_HERE]/mcp"
    }
  }
}
